Perfect Combination of Lux and Fun
This is our second Saab and it has proven to be as much fun as the 9-3 it's parked next to. An excellent combination of luxury (OnStar, XM radio, leather, high-intensity headlamps, Bose sound, sun roof, heated seats, rear climate control, dual-zone climate control - all standard), fun, capability (V8, easy cruising in the mountains, up to 6500 lbs towing), and support (free 1 yr. OnStar, free 36 mo. scheduled maintenance, 100,000 mile power train warranty). Don't listen to the 'expert' reviewers - some of them have not even driven it. You have to drive it to appreciate that it is performance tuned by Saab and outfitted with more luxury than it's GM cousins.

New Saab owner
I looked the the GMC Envoy Denalli and SLT with the 4.2. In the Envoy there was a huge difference between the Denalli and the SLT with the 4.2. The 9-7x falls right in between as far a comfort and ride. You get much more luxury with the 9-7 than with the Envoy SLT. The 9-7's ride and handling with the lower profile and larger wheels makes a dramatic difference. Unless you actually want to drive somewhere off road, I would choose the 9-7 vs its GM brothers. The downside is the quality and fit and finish are still GM. You're not buying a lexus.
